比特币核心钱包生成地址的全面指南
在当今的数字经济中,比特币作为一种去中心化的加密货币,受到了越来越多的关注。比特币核心钱包是比特币网络中最原始和可靠的钱包之一。本文将深入探讨比特币核心钱包生成地址的过程、原理以及相关的技术细节,以帮助读者更好地理解如何使用这一工具进行安全的比特币交易。
1. 什么是比特币核心钱包?
比特币核心钱包(Bitcoin Core)是比特币网络的官方钱包,作为一个开源软件,它不仅为用户提供了存储和管理比特币的功能,还通过运行全节点支持网络的安全性和去中心化。核心钱包是由比特币的创始人中本聪在2009年首次发布的,至今仍然是比特币存储的首选之一。
核心钱包的一个显著特点是,它需要下载整个比特币区块链,这意味着需要较大的存储空间和良好的网络连接。然而,这种深度参与也意味着用户可以更好地控制自己的比特币,并有机会参与网络的治理。
2. 比特币地址生成的原理
比特币地址是用于接收比特币的标识符。每个地址实际上是比特币公钥的散列值,通常采用 Base58Check 编码表示。生成比特币地址的过程包括以下几个步骤:
- 生成私钥:比特币的私钥是一系列随机生成的数字和字母,具有128位的强度,确保了其安全性。
- 生成公钥:使用椭圆曲线加密算法(ECDSA)将私钥转化为公钥。这个过程是不可逆的,意味着无法从公钥推导出私钥。
- 计算地址:对公钥进行SHA-256和RIPEMD-160散列,得到比特币地址的核心部分。在生成最终地址之前,还需要进行Base58Check编码,以确保地址的易读性并添加对地址错误的基本保护。
生成的比特币地址通常以数字“1”、“3”或“bc1”开头,分别代表不同类型的地址格式(P2PKH、P2SH和Bech32)。
3. 如何在比特币核心钱包中生成地址?
在比特币核心钱包中生成地址相对简单,用户只需遵循以下步骤:
- 下载与安装钱包:首先需要在比特币官网上下载比特币核心钱包,并根据你的操作系统完成安装。
- 启动钱包:打开钱包应用并等待其同步区块链。
- 创建新地址:在钱包界面中,点击“接收”选项卡,点击“生成新地址”按钮。系统会自动为你生成一个新地址。
- 保存地址:记得将钱包生成的地址妥善保存,并确保不会泄露给他人。
此外,比特币核心钱包还提供了多种管理地址的功能,包括标记地址、导出地址等,方便用户进行分类和管理。
4. 保护你的比特币地址
一旦生成比特币地址,保护它的安全就变得尤为重要。以下是一些建议:
- 备份钱包数据:定期备份比特币核心钱包的数据,以防数据丢失或钱包损坏。
- 使用强密码:设置一个强密码来保护钱包,避免不法分子的入侵。
- 启用两步验证:对于一些附加服务或交易所,启用两步验证可以增加安全性。
- 警惕钓鱼攻击:确保访问钱包和交易所时使用官方网站,避免钓鱼网站的攻击。
通过采取这几种措施,可以显著提高比特币地址及其持有资产的安全性。
相关问题探讨
比特币核心钱包和其它钱包的区别是什么?
比特币核心钱包是比特币网络的官方钱包,其最大的优势在于它的安全性和对比特币网络的深度参与。与其他钱包相比,它的优势和不足之处在于:
- 安全性:比特币核心钱包通过全节点的方式来确保交易的安全,能够对区块链进行完整验证,提高了用户资产安全。
- 可控制性:用户对钱包的完全控制,不依赖于中心化服务,真实拥有私钥。
- 资源消耗:下载整个区块链需要较多的存储空间和带宽,对初学者可能不太友好。
- 用户体验:相较于一些轻量级钱包(如移动钱包、网页钱包),核心钱包的界面和操作较为复杂,适合有一定技术基础的用户。
总结来说,如果用户更加重视安全性和控制权,推荐使用比特币核心钱包;而如果只是偶尔交易,轻量级的钱包可能更方便。
比特币地址会过期吗?
比特币地址本身并不会过期。一旦生成的地址,你可以永久使用它接收比特币。然而,由于以下原因,可能需要注意:
- 隐私为了保护隐私,建议用户定期生成新的地址。如果使用一个地址多次接受交易,可能导致链上分析并暴露个人信息。
- 安全性如果私钥泄露,那么相关地址中的比特币将不再安全。因此,用户需要谨慎管理私钥,并在发现私钥泄露后停止使用该地址。
- 网络升级:在某些网络升级中,可能会出现模型变更,导致旧地址变得不兼容。因此,保持钱包的软件升级是必要的。
综上所述,比特币地址虽然不会过期,但用户需要特别关注隐私和安全等方面。
为何要使用比特币核心钱包?
使用比特币核心钱包的原因主要有以下几点:
- 最高的安全性:比特币核心钱包的全节点机制使得用户可以在自身设备上拥有完整的区块链数据,从而实现完全集中加密货币资产的管理。
- 完全控制权:相较于第三方钱包,核心钱包给予用户完整的私钥控制权,确保资产不受外部攻击。
- 支持网络福利:参与全节点不仅提供交易安全性,同时也支持比特币网络的健康运作,对整个生态是一种积极贡献。
- 优惠的手续费率:使用核心钱包进行交易时,用户可以自由选择手续费,根据网络情况自行交易速度。
归根结底,尽管核心钱包的操作较为复杂,但其提供的安全性和控制权使其成为重视安全和隐私的用户的首选。
如何解决比特币核心钱包同步问题?
在使用比特币核心钱包的过程中,许多用户可能会遇到同步缓慢的问题。以下是一些解决方案:
- 更新软件:确保你的比特币核心钱包是最新版本,以获得系统的和增强功能。定期检查官方发布的更新。
- 连接:如果你的网络连接不太稳定,尝试连接更强的互联网或使用VPN来提高数据传输的质量。
- 修改设置:调调整钱包的连接设置,适当增加可用连接节点的数量,以增强同步速度。
- 使用压缩数据:在初次安装时,可以通过启用压缩模式来降低下载的数据量,加快同步速度。
综上所述,比特币核心钱包的同步问题可以通过多种方式进行,确保用户尽快体验到这款安全钱包的优势。